Top 5 Sports Apps on Android in Bahrain - Q3 2023
Discover the top-performing sports apps on Android in Bahrain for Q3 2023, including their weekly downloads and revenue trends.
In Q3 2023, the sports app market in Bahrain on the Android platform saw notable performance from five key apps. Here’s a detailed breakdown based on data from Sensor Tower.
EA SPORTS FC™ Mobile Soccer from ELECTRONIC ARTS experienced a fluctuating revenue trend, peaking at approximately $2.2K in the first week of July before gradually declining to around $254 by the end of September. Weekly downloads for the app saw a significant spike in the final week of September, reaching 1.9K, up from 775 at the start of the quarter.
8 Ball Pool by Miniclip.com showed a stable revenue pattern, with earnings around $487 in late June, tapering off to $268 by the end of September. The app’s weekly downloads exhibited a peak of 1.1K in the last week of September, following an upward trend from 662 in late June.
Football League 2024 from MOBILE SOCCER, despite not generating any revenue, saw varying download numbers. The app’s weekly downloads started at 460 in late June, peaked at over 1K in early August, and settled at 567 by the end of the quarter.
Carrom Pool: Disc Game from Miniclip.com had a consistent revenue stream, starting at $76 in late June and fluctuating around $69 to $144 through the quarter. The app’s downloads remained steady, peaking at 613 in early August before slightly declining to 446 by the end of September.
Head Ball 2 - Online Soccer from Masomo Gaming saw its revenue peak at $264 in late July, then gradually decline to just $34 by the end of September. Downloads for the app were highest at 829 in early July and saw a gradual decrease, ending the quarter at 283.
